Spokane Sch. Dist. No. 81 v. Spokane Educ. Ass 'n
After providing that "[n]on renewal of provisional employees and matters relating
to evaluation ... shall be grievable only through Step Three" of the grievance procedure,
the CBA goes on to state that "[ s]uch grievance shall pertain solely to alleged procedural
discrepancies." CP at 109. Accordingly, procedural discrepancies arising during the
processing of a grievance are themselves subject to the article VII, section 3 limitations
and are therefore not arbitrable. Were that not clear from the language of the provision
itself we would conclude, as we have above, that because the only remedy sought by the
amended grievance is another year of provisional employment the grievance is essentially
challenging the district's evaluation and nonrenewal, thereby subjecting that basis for the
grievance to article VII, section 3.
